As America prepares for the celebration of the 500th anniversary of the discovery of the New World, Kirkpatrick Sale asks us to reconsider the common myths surrounding Christopher Columbus. 重新审视美国的起源:哥伦布。

In his most recent book, The Conquest of Paradise: Christopher Columbus and the Columbian Legacy (1991), Mr. Sale presents a revised version of the storied seaman, describing him as "unstable, rootless, avaricious, and deceptive." According to Mr. Sale, Europe's "encounter" with the New World is responsible for many of the political and environmental problems of our time.

The Indians lived in peace and harmony with nature, while the Europeans were more concerned with the domination of the world around them.This focus on dominance, over nature as well as over the Indians, eventually spread throughout the world.Mr. Sale holds the Europeans accountable for nations warring over land and for the world-wide pollution of our air and water.
